## Idempotency Keys for Payment Retries (Lumopay)

Every retry of a charge request must reuse the original idempotency key; generating a new key on retry can produce duplicate charges. Keys are scoped per merchant and expire after 48 hours. Reviewers should verify keys are derived server-side, never from client input. The full key-generation specification and threat model are maintained on the internal page.

dashboard of kaguf-tawip = https://vault.merlaqsys.test/issue

Changelog v3.8 — Slabdiff defaults changed. Heads up for new folks: we bumped the large-file threshold and switched the default render mode to streaming, since the old eager mode kept eating memory on monorepo diffs. Syntax highlighting now auto-disables past the size cap instead of crashing. If your local setup misbehaves, compare against the new shipped defaults, which are as follows.

deployment values, yadug-bawif:
[framir]
team = pelox
access_code = ac_a38ab2
owner = tamion.julael
host = framir.tolvaqlabs.test
port = 11211
peer = tammir.zemvargrid.local
salt = 2215ef03
pin = 1541

Spreadsheet exports in Ledgerline are memory-hungry: each export worker streams rows in 10k-row chunks, but formula-heavy sheets can still spike RSS above 2 GB. Support should check EXPORT_CHUNK_SIZE before escalating, and never raise worker concurrency past 3 on the Marrowick tier. Exports also call the archival service for completed files, and that service's access credential must be placed on the line immediately following this sentence.

env line for fafof-fahag: LEDGER_TOKEN5=f8790